(In reply to comment #2)
> Paul,
> 
> I don't feel confortable creating a bundle of Log::Dispatch,
> Log::Dispatch::FileRotate, and Log::Log4perl because:
> 
>  i) these three perl distros are maintained by different people (the three
> DateTime modules that have been bundled are all maintained by Dave Rolsky)
> 
>   ii) the circular dependencies are only caused by the test suite
> as this module only extends Log::Dispatch but uses Log::Log4perl as it
> main log infrastructure in the test suite (most likely, the test suite
> should be redone using only Log::Dispatch or, at least, conditional
> require Log::Log4perl).
> 
> iii) The author of Log::Dispatch::FileRotate doesn't appear to be very
> responsive, at leasat judging from the rt tickets
> (http://rt.cpan.org/NoAuth/Bugs.html?Dist=Log-Dispatch-FileRotate); at least I
> haven't got any answer for #14563.

OK, that's fair enough.

Is there a precedent in Extras for calling perl modules (or anything else for
that matter) "distributable" in the absence of any specific licensing terms
being included upstream?

Looking at rt for this module, the author appears to be completely unresponsive
to rt tickets. Perhaps it's worth trying to contact him directly?
